How much do full time solar panel sales jobs pay per year?

As of Jun 1, 2026, the average yearly pay for full time solar panel sales in the United States is $132,389.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$77,500.00 and $144,000.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

Job description

Solar Installer - Residential Installation
Company: Better Earth Inc.
Location: Sacramento CA
Job Type: Full-Time
Pay: $25.00 per hour
About Better Earth
Better Earth is a leading residential solar installation company dedicated to making clean energy accessible for homeowners. We design, install, and maintain high-quality solar energy systems across California and beyond. Join a growing team that's building a sustainable future - one rooftop at a time.
Position Summary
We are hiring motivated Solar Installers to join our residential installation crews. As a Solar Installer, you will work alongside experienced Crew Leads and Roof Leads to install rooftop solar panel systems on homes. This is an excellent entry point into the fast-growing solar and renewable energy industry - whether you're an experienced installer looking for a great team or someone with construction/roofing experience ready to break into solar. We provide hands-on training and a clear path for career advancement.
Key Responsibilities
• Assist in the installation of residential rooftop solar photovoltaic (PV) systems including panels, racking, mounting hardware, and electrical components
• Carry, stage, and position solar panels, racking materials, conduit, wiring, and other installation equipment on rooftops and job sites
• Perform roof work including laying out arrays, securing mounting hardware, and assisting with roof penetrations and flashing under Roof Lead direction
• Pull and secure electrical conduit, wiring, and junction boxes per engineering plans and NEC code
• Assist with ground-level work including trenching, equipment pad preparation, and inverter/electrical panel installations
• Follow all OSHA safety standards, fall protection protocols, and company safety procedures at all times
• Maintain a clean, organized, and hazard-free job site throughout the workday
• Load and unload materials and equipment from company vehicles
• Use power tools, hand tools, and measuring instruments safely and effectively
• Provide a positive, professional customer experience - represent Better Earth with courtesy and respect on every job site
• Complete daily safety checklists, job reports, and documentation as directed by Crew Lead
• Drive company vehicles to and from job sites as needed
